Transaction 388142ce6bce91ee90f202763204a81bcbdd554683a76138beb1e99443023747
1 Input
1 Output
-
388142ce6bce91ee90f202763204a81bcbdd554683a76138beb1e99443023747:0
- value
- 89236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 beda74b507ffabd9fbbe576dc2e5556ab9adf328 OP_EQUAL
- address
- 3K6A1aAkwMA7C8f39FsuB6sSFSzXcEXkKC